Output 3cc857cad75388154930d79af4be06535067e85f30958632dac1112853676b8f:0

value
277921
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95a1a67fdfdc409f38ebdb43c50211107dbe60ab OP_EQUAL
address
3FLCFnut432Moft5VBqc4j6o9AeWuMzUgX
transaction
3cc857cad75388154930d79af4be06535067e85f30958632dac1112853676b8f
confirmations
67933
spent
true